MINNEAPOLIS – The Minnesota Lynx are 7.5-point favorites against the Phoenix Mercury in the second game of the WNBA Semifinals. The Lynx had no problem winning and covering against Phoenix in the first game of the series, with a final score of 82-69. The Lynx were favored by 9.5 points in that game.
In the first round of the playoffs, Minnesota crushed the Golden State Valkyries by 29 at home and won game two on the road by one point. This has been a theme in the regular season as well, with the Lynx outscoring their opponents by an average of 15.5 points at home and 8.4 on the road.
Over the regular season, Minnesota went 18-2 at home and 13-6 on the road.
Sportsbooks do not expect the Lynx to have any trouble moving on to the next round, as they are the heavy favorite to win the WNBA Finals (-290) and have been for the majority of the season.
